What is a remote billboard designer?

Remote Billboard Designers are graphic design professionals who create visual advertisements specifically for billboard displays while working from a remote location. They use digital tools to design engaging, large-scale graphics that capture attention and convey messages effectively. These designers collaborate with clients, marketing teams, or agencies online to understand campaign goals, brand guidelines, and technical specifications. Their work often involves adapting designs for different billboard sizes and locations, ensuring high resolution and visibility from a distance.

What does a remote billboard designer do when collaborating with clients and marketing teams?

As a remote billboard designer, much of your collaboration happens virtually using tools like email, video calls, and project management platforms. You'll regularly communicate with clients, marketing teams, and copywriters to understand campaign objectives, incorporate feedback, and ensure your designs align with brand guidelines. Sharing drafts, discussing revisions, and participating in brainstorming sessions are common parts of the workflow. Strong communication skills and the ability to clearly present design concepts are crucial for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ote billboard designer?

A Remote Billboard Designer needs strong graphic design skills, creativity, and proficiency in design principles, often supported by a degree in graphic design or a related field. Mastery of tools like Adobe Photoshop, Illustrator, and cloud-based collaboration platforms is typically required. Exceptional communication, time management, and the ability to interpret client briefs are crucial soft skills for this position. These skills ensure visually impactful billboard designs that effectively convey messages while meeting client objectives and deadlines in a remote work environment.

What is the difference between Remote Billboard Designer vs Remote Graphic Designer?

AspectRemote Billboard DesignerRemote Graphic Designer
CredentialsDesign degree or portfolio, proficiency in design softwareDesign degree or portfolio, proficiency in design software
Work EnvironmentFocus on outdoor advertising, billboard specificationsVarious media including digital, print, branding
Industry UsageAdvertising, outdoor marketingMarketing, media, branding, advertising
Search & Comparison IntentSpecific to outdoor billboard designBroader design roles across media

Remote Billboard Designers specialize in creating visual content specifically for outdoor billboards, requiring knowledge of outdoor advertising standards. Remote Graphic Designers have a broader scope, working across various media types like digital, print, and branding. While both roles require similar design skills and software proficiency, Billboard Designers focus on outdoor advertising projects, making their work more specialized compared to the versatile role of Graphic Designers.
